Village Super Market, Inc. operates a chain of supermarkets in the United States, including ShopRite, Fairway Markets, and Gourmet Garage specialty stores in the Mid-Atlantic region. Its stores offer departments such as on-site bakery and delicatessen offerings, along with natural and organic foods and pharmacies.
Village Super Market runs supermarket stores (ShopRite, Fairway Markets, and Gourmet Garage) and makes money by selling groceries with specialty departments, including an on-site bakery, expanded delicatessen, natural and organic foods, ethnic and international foods, prepared foods, and pharmacies.
Its profit engine is selling everyday customer demand through physical supermarket locations, where the store concept blends core grocery with higher-touch specialty offerings (prepared foods, bakery, delicatessen, and pharmacy).
